I only know... hmm... second or third or something edition. For the unenlightened:

It's goofy and awesome.

Or a little bit longer: first, there came the far future. With energy weapons and power armor and gigantic flying fortresses and robots. Then came a nuclear war and it was all blown to bits. Everyone mutated.

Actually, so far, it sounds like Fallout. It isn't.

For character creation, in the game I played, you chose a race first. Human, Mutant, Mutated Animal or Mutated Plant. Animals included such stupid things as octopus or different kinds of bird. Then you rolled on a table for random mutations and got things like a second head, brain included, the psychic power to shoot lasers from your eyes or gas bags which can make you float.

I only played one round, but it was incredibly whacky, stupid and fun. The mission our GM sent us through was a standard module... we had to explore an abandoned museum/planetarium while dodging janitor combat robots, the "other planets in the solar system" simulation which included vacuum, the gravity of jupiter and the cold of pluto. Then we had to convince a sentient nuclear missile to not blow itself up and then outrun the explosion in a pre-war jeep.
